Washington, July 11 (RHC)-- The Barack Obama administration has acknowleged a breach of government computer systems was far worse than they initally disclosed.
Hackers stole information including fingerprints and Social Security numbers from 21.5 million people. The Office of Personnel Management said everyone who received a government background check over the last 15 years was likely impacted.
